No bad reactions here, but I recently discovered that companies are sneaking sucralose (Splenda) into products that aren't labeled low sugar or sugar free.
I noticed that fake-sweetner whang in Vlasic bread & butter pickles. Sure enough, sucralose is on the ingredients list but nowhere else. The Kroger brand pickles have it too, but not the "old fashioned" style. Since then, I've also seen it in Kroger brand ice cream sandwiches and Thomas English muffins.
